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Minor ceiling water stain (less than 1 sq ft) | Yes | No | Easily cleaned and dried with fans. |
| Small, localized sewage backup (few gallons) | No | Yes | Sewage is a biohazard and requires special handling. |
| Slight musty odor in a bathroom | Maybe | Yes | Could indicate hidden mold growth behind walls. |
| Full basement flood from a burst pipe | No | Yes | Requires professional water extraction and drying to prevent structural damage and mold. |
| Smoke damage from a small contained fire | Maybe | Yes | Soot and smoke odors are difficult to remove completely without specialized equipment. |
| Loose shingle after a wind storm | Maybe | Yes | Best to have it inspected to prevent further water intrusion. |
While some minor issues can be handled yourself, significant water, fire, or mold damage requires professional intervention. Trying to DIY these situations can often lead to secondary damage and increased costs down the line.

Estimated Restoration Costs In Kamas
The cost of restoration varies widely depending on the extent of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the specific materials and labor involved. These figures are general estimates for Kamas homeowners and an on-site assessment will provide a more precise quote. Our team is committed to transparent pricing and clear communication.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Damage Restoration (Minor) | $500 – $2,500 | Amount of water, drying time needed, and material replacement. |
| Water Damage Restoration (Major Flood) | $2,500 – $15,000+ | Extent of saturation, structural drying, potential demolition, and reconstruction. |
| Fire Damage Restoration | $2,000 – $10,000+ | Severity of fire, soot and smoke levels, and cleaning/deodorizing complexity. |
| Mold Remediation (Small Area) | $500 – $2,000 | Size of infestation, type of mold, and accessibility. |
| Mold Remediation (Large Area) | $2,000 – $7,000+ | Extensive contamination, HVAC system impact, and containment protocols. |
| Storm Damage Repair (Roof/Siding) | $1,000 – $5,000+ | Type of storm damage, materials needed, and extent of repairs. |

What should I do if I find mold in my home?
If you suspect or see mold, your first step is to isolate the area if possible and avoid disturbing it. Do not try to clean it yourself with household products, as this can spread spores. Call us immediately; our certified technicians will safely contain and remove the mold, addressing the moisture source to prevent its return.
How long does the water damage restoration process typically take?
The timeline for water damage restoration can vary significantly. For minor leaks, drying might take 2-3 days. More extensive flooding, especially in structures with denser materials, could take a week or more for complete drying and restoration. Will my homeowner’s insurance cover the damage?
Most homeowner’s insurance policies cover damage from sudden and accidental events like burst pipes or storm damage. However, coverage for slow leaks or neglect might be limited. We work closely with your insurance company to help you understand your coverage and facilitate a smooth claims process.
What’s the difference between water damage and fire damage restoration?
Water damage restoration focuses on removing excess moisture, drying structures, and preventing mold. Fire damage restoration involves cleaning soot and smoke residue, deodorizing, and repairing structural damage caused by the fire and water used to extinguish it.
